#f42780 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f42780 is composed of 95.7% red, 15.3% green and 50.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 84% magenta, 47.5%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 334 degrees, a saturation of 90.3% and a lightness of 55.5%. #f42780 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ff4eff with #e90001. Closest websafe color is: #ff3399.

#f42780 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f42780 has RGB values of R:244, G:39, B:128 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.84, Y:0.48,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 16000896.

Shades and Tints of #f42780
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080004 is the darkest color, while #fef4f9 is the lightest one.
